To flatten a bent or warped disc golf disc, use high-temperature heat or weight to re-form a plastic disc into the desired shape. The best method to flatten a bent or warped golf disc is using the sun to heat the disc, placing the disc in boiling water, or leaving a weight on the disc to force it into the desired shape.

How do you fix a concave disc?

Boil water.Find bowl same size as disc rim.Place disc rim upside down on rim of bowl.Do this in a sink.Fill disc with boiling water.As soon as the disc pops back into place blast it with cold water to make it hold it's shape.Quit leaving your bag in your hot car. Can you sand a disc golf disc?

This rule does not forbid inevitable wear and tear from usage during play or the moderate sanding of discs to smooth molding imperfections or scrape marks. Discs excessively sanded or painted with a material of detectable thickness are illegal.

How long does it take to break in a disc golf disc?

Different factors can play into the length of time it takes. So, depending on these main factors, a disc could be broken in less than 6 months after it's brand new or even up to several years. But, on average you're going to be in a range of 6 to 12 months to break in a brand new disc golf disc.

What is a Hyzer Flip?

A Hyzer Flip is very similar to an S-Shot but follows a straighter line. An understable disc is thrown very fast with a hyzer angle of release. The disc turns or “flips” up and brings its nose down in the process. This allows for a long straight glide.

Why does my disc curve left?

Perhaps the most common culprit of discs going hard left is the player's release angle. Most of us tend to naturally have what we call in disc golf a “hyzer” release. This means the disc is tilted down and left when you throw it and basic physics will tell you that the disc will fly on the angle it is thrown.

How do you fix Anhyzer release?

Possible Fix: Leaning back a little bit with a slight back arch will help to pull the outter edge of the disc upwards and make an anhyzer angle easier to achieve. This might feel a bit awkward but this is how I've been taught to throw big turnover and roller shots. Check for proper disc pivot angle.

Can you do a push putt with a straddle putt?

When completing a straddle putt, you can perform a spin or push putt within the process. By straddling your legs, a hip thrust will reduce any side-to-side movement, allowing for great steadiness. However, you may lose power and distance with this throw.
